Nigeria, Feb. 17 -- Friday's announcement of the death of Pa Ayo Adebanjo came as a rude shock to most Nigerians. For a nonagenarian, death can come at any time but Pa Adebanjo was rarely reported as being ill and was very active until his death.

He was very active and spoke so clearly, intelligently and never showed signs of any of those debilitating ailments associated with older people.

Pa Adebanjo cannot be said to have died young at 96, but if there is one Nigerian badly needed today, more than ever before, to guide us to building that united nation that has remained elusive for so long, he surely is that person.
